Market Definition and Overview
The digital battlefield market encompasses the integration of advanced digital technologies such as artificial intelligence, big data analytics, the Internet of Things (IoT), and cloud computing within military operations to enhance situational awareness, decision-making, and operational efficiency. This market includes solutions like cyber warfare systems, communication networks, unmanned systems, and real-time data processing platforms, all designed to provide a strategic edge on the battlefield.

Market Dynamics
Market Drivers
The digital battlefield market is experiencing robust growth driven by several key factors. Firstly, technological innovations such as Artificial Intelligence (AI) and the Internet of Things (IoT) are transforming military operations. For instance, IoT adoption in military applications is projected to increase by 35% annually through 2026, driven by the need for enhanced situational awareness and real-time data processing. Secondly, rising end-user demand for advanced defense systems is accelerating market expansion. As governments worldwide increase defense budgets, global military spending reached $1.98 trillion in 2023, fueling investments in digital battlefield technologies. Thirdly, regulatory tailwinds, such as supportive defense policies and increased security protocols, are encouraging the adoption of digital solutions. Finally, the push towards enterprise digitization is compelling original equipment manufacturers (OEMs) to integrate cutting-edge technology, ensuring competitive advantage and operational efficiency.
Market Restraints
Despite the promising growth, the digital battlefield market faces significant restraints. One major barrier is the high cost of deploying advanced technologies, which can deter smaller defense contractors from entering the market. Additionally, cybersecurity concerns remain a critical issue, as defense systems are increasingly targeted by sophisticated cyber threats. For example, in 2023, cyber-attacks on military networks increased by 28%, highlighting vulnerabilities in existing infrastructures. Furthermore, the complex integration of multiple systems often leads to interoperability challenges, delaying the deployment of cohesive digital battlefield solutions.

Market Challenges
Several challenges could potentially restrict the future growth of the digital battlefield market. Regulatory uncertainties, particularly regarding the export of defense technologies, pose significant hurdles. The high upfront costs associated with new technology development and deployment also remain a concern. Furthermore, the market is hampered by infrastructure and technical limitations, such as inadequate bandwidth and latency issues, which impede real-time data processing. Skilled labor shortages in cybersecurity and data analytics further exacerbate these issues, while fragmented markets with complex compliance requirements continue to challenge seamless operations and international collaborations.
